What is a paragraph?


A paragraph is a group of related sentences that inform the reader an idea, it consist of many sentences that work together to explain about the idea of that paragraph.

A good paragraph consist of three parts :
The first is topic sentence, it is normally the first sentence of paragraph. It is the most important thing in paragraph because it helps the reader knows about the whole of it and it is the main idea of it.
The second is supporting sentences, they come after the topic sentence. These are sentences that support the topic sentence. They explain about the main idea of the paragraph. The supporting sentences must be supporting facts, details, and specific example.
The third is concluding idea, it is the last sentence in a paragraph and it summarizes the main idea of the paragraph.

There are seven types of paragraphs:
  1. Narration: Narrative paragraphs tell a story, it is formed from several events which combine into a story. It is usually contains of characters, a setting, a conflict, and a resolution. Time and place and person are normally established in this paragraph.
  2. Exposition: Exposition is paragraph explains something, it must be trusted and believable.  
  3. Definition: Definition is paragraph that defines something. It must be written in a simple word so that the reader will understand about what the writer says.
  4. Description: descriptive paragraph is written in order to make the reader is able to imagine the scene, object, person, etc. It makes the reader know what it looks like even though they never see it.  
  5. Comparison: it is paragraph written to compare two or more objects, characters, and etc.
  6. Process Analysis is describes how a process happens. This type of paragraph is usually followed by illustration to help in understanding of process better.
  7. Persuasion: this paragraph is written in such a way to persuade people to change their minds or take an action. In this paragraph the writer needs to supply the reader with the information, analysis, and context they need. Because it very important to influence the reader, and form their new opinion, and take action.
